Oknoname 107002
Oknoname 107002 is an earth dam located in Okfuskee County, Oklahoma, built in 1950. It carries a Undetermined hazard potential classification.
About Oknoname 107002
Oknoname 107002 is a dam in Okfuskee, Oklahoma. The dam is owned by Hugh Stanley (private). It impounds the Tr-north Canadian River near Weleetka.
The dam stands 35 feet tall and stretches 720 feet across, creates a reservoir covering 7 acres, and has a maximum storage capacity of 400 acre-feet. Completed in 1950, the structure is well-established, with more than 75 years of service.
The most recent inspection on record was 12/06/2001. That was over 24 years ago.
At 35 feet, this dam is taller than 82% of dams nationwide.
